Cost of Living in Curepipe - Updated Prices & Insights

Solo nomad: Estimated monthly costs are $476 (excluding rent), and $927 including rent.
Family of 3: Estimated monthly costs are $1,391 (excluding rent), and $2,072 including rent.

Cost of Living in Curepipe - Frequently Asked Questions
How does the overall affordability in Curepipe, Mauritius stack up for travelers, expats, and digital nomads?
Cost of Living in Curepipe, Mauritius sits in a middle range for the island, offering a practical balance between accessibility and quality of life. You'll find quieter residential areas near the town center with reasonable rents relative to the capital, plus affordable local eats, markets, and transport options if you opt for public or shared services. Shopping around for longer-term housing helps stabilize monthly costs, and choosing local brands over imported products can trim expenses. Seasonality affects leisure choices more than necessities, so plan your activities with the climate in mind. Tip: Map a monthly plan that covers housing, groceries, transport, and occasional experiences to keep spending steady.
What does daily life look like in Curepipe, including housing search, food options, transport, and work spaces?
Daily life revolves around a quiet, accessible town with hillside streets and practical services. You'll find a mix of apartment options and stand-alone homes in Curepipe with rental ranges that tend to be friendlier than the bustling coast. For groceries, local markets provide fresh produce at reasonable prices, while supermarkets offer imported goods at a premium; balance between both. Public transport links to Port Louis and other towns are available, with taxi apps as reliable late-evening options. For remote work, seek co-working spaces or cafes with solid Wi-Fi and a comfortable crowd. Curepipe, Mauritius living cost is manageable when you plan around off-peak hours. Tip: Build routines around local timing to save time and money.
